打开命令行工具(例如CMD或PowerShell),导航到你的QT项目的构建目录(通常是包含生成的exe文件的目录),然后运行以下命令: bash windeployqt.exe your_project_executable.exe 其中your_project_executable.exe是你的QT项目生成的exe文件的名称。 测试打包结果: 在打包完成后,找到生成的exe文件(通常在与你的项目构建目录...
linux 下编译的程序 可以用 mingw 来编译成 win 下的程序.不过不是100%可行,也许会有一些不兼容.
建议使用 QTemporaryFile::createNativeFile 函数将qrc中的文件copy到一个本地目录,然后再去播放本地文...
2. 准备文件夹结构 在你的程序编译后的exe文件所在目录(比如./release/)创建一个新的文件夹,如 `MyApp`。将编译生成的exe文件(例如`myapp.exe`)复制到 `MyApp` 文件夹中。 在`MyApp` 文件夹内,创建一个名为 `platforms` 的子文件夹。后面我们需要将平台插件放入这个文件夹。 3. 复制依赖库文件 在你的Qt...
首先,您需要在您的计算机上安装Qt SDK。在安装过程中,建议选择在线安装器,并在选择组件时键入“MinGW”,该程序包包括MinGW编译器,这对于创建独立的.exe应用程序非常重要。 2. 编译和构建Qt应用程序 使用Qt Creator打开您的项目并构建它。构建成功后,输出目录(通常称为“release”)将包含一个名为“your_app.exe”...
建议使用 QTemporaryFile::createNativeFile 函数将qrc中的文件copy到一个本地目录,然后再去播放本地...
Qt封装成exe的主要原理是将应用程序的所有依赖库、插件以及构建文件捆绑在一个单一的可执行文件中。这样,用户在不安装Qt开发环境的情况下也能运行应用程序。以下是Qt封装成exe的详细步骤: 1. 准备环境: 确保已安装Qt开发环境和编译器(如MinGW,MSVC等)。这些工具将用于构建应用程序以及生成可执行文件。此外,确保已设...
1. 编译项目:在 Qt Creator 中打开您的项目并将其编译为 Release 版本。选择“构建”菜单,然后选择“构建项目”以进行构建。完成后,可以在构建目录中找到可执行的 .exe 文件。 2. 创建文件目录:创建一个新文件夹,将该文件夹用作存储打包后的应用程序和依赖项。将编译生成的 .exe 文件复制到该文件夹中。
使用Qt创建应用程序的过程通常包括编写代码、编译和链接,最后是部署。而将Qt程序制作成可执行文件(exe)是在Windows系统下部署Qt应用程序的一个重要组成部分。这里将为你详细介绍将Qt程序制作成exe文件的过程。 首先确定你已经安装了Qt开发环境(包括Qt库、Qt Creator等)以及一个适当的编译器(例如:Microsoft Visual Studi...
Qt生成exe文件的过程主要可以分为以下几个步骤:编写源代码、编译、链接 和部署。这里,我将为您详细说明每个步骤的原理和具体操作。 1. 编写源代码 首先,您需要使用C++和Qt库编写一个Qt应用程序。Qt库提供了大量的类和函数用于开发具有图形用户界面(GUI)的应用程序。通常情况下,一个简单的Qt应用程序包含QApplication...